Ebara Corporation is a leading Japanese industrial machinery manufacturer specializing in fluid dynamics technology, including pumps, compressors, and turbines. The company operates across three core segments: Fluid Machinery & Systems (pumps, compressors), Environmental Plants (wastewater treatment, incineration), and Precision Machinery (semiconductor manufacturing equipment). Ebara holds a strong global position in high-performance pumps for industrial and infrastructure applications, with significant market share in Asia and growing presence in North America and Europe. The company's competitive advantages include deep engineering expertise, a reputation for reliability in critical applications, and long-term relationships with industrial clients in energy, water, and semiconductor sectors.
Holds over 2,000 patents globally, with active R&D in energy-efficient pump technologies and advanced wastewater treatment systems. Leading developer of maglev centrifugal chillers for data center cooling applications.
